Who can file a wrongful death lawsuit in San Diego?
Typically, the immediate family members, such as spouses, children, or parents, can file a wrongful death claim in San Diego.
What is the time limit to file a wrongful death lawsuit in San Diego?
In San Diego, the statute of limitations for filing a wrongful death lawsuit is generally two years from the date of death.
Do I have to go to court for a wrongful death case in San Diego?
Not necessarily. Many cases are settled through negotiation, but our San Diego attorneys are fully prepared to litigate in court if a fair settlement cannot be reached.
